We can’t believe it’s taken us this long to spotlight Lana Del Rey, whose music seems tailor-made for us. Raised in the winter olympics village of Lake Placid in upstate New York, Del Rey (a.k.a. Lizzy Grant) struck out for less snowbound pastures as soon as she could; the singer-songwriter now splits her time between London and New York. Crafting elegant pop that sounds familiar – yet unlike anything else garnering airplay on the radio at the moment – Del Rey and her singular voice is already earning legions of fans with her moody hit single, “Video Games.”

Just a quick update on how the weekend went for our Roxy Canada surfers at the Queen of the Peak event in Tofino. To set the stage: Tofino boasts some amazing female surf talent for being a tiny remote Canadian community.

These girls could hold their own in warm temperature contests (and some of them do spend the balance of the year in Indonesia and Hawaii’s North Shore).

Over 50 girls competed so it was a well-deserved double victory for Roxy Canada’s Hanna Scott who won both the shortboard and longboard category.

Roxy Canada’s Catherine Bruhwiler, the local legend, surfed really well but as contests sometimes go, she had a tougher time in the final heat yet still finished with a very impressive 3rd in longboard and 4rd in shortboard.

After a theatrical release in Europe, the heart-warming and action-packed film “Chalet Girl” has hit the U.S. and is now available on Cable Video-On-Demand, iTunes, Xbox, Amazon and Sundancenow.com. If you live in New York or LA and prefer an outing out with your girlfriends to watch the film, it’s showing at the IFC Center in NYC and starts showing at Laemmle’s Monica 4-Plex in Santa Monica on October 21.

The story revolves around Kim, a pretty tomboy trying to support her dad. When she’s offered the opportunity to move to The Alps and become a Chalet Girl, she jumps on the offer and discovers she has the opportunity to do so much more. She quickly learns to snowboard in hopes of winning a the ROXY Pro Snowboard Contest.

Another plus: ROXY’s Pro Team rider Kjersti Buaas is in the film as herself. Catch her ride and act in the film!

With a name derived from singer Angela Correa’s last name, Los Angeles’ Correatown has become the latest buzz band in the city’s thriving music scene. Rounded out by Mike Corwin, Jenni Tarma, and Rob Poynter, the quartet crafts dreamy soundscapes like on single “Further.” We think it sounds awesome after a night spent driving L.A.’s never-empty streets. We’ve quickly become major fans of the band’s quietly emotional new album, Etch The Line.

This weekend, Sally Fitzgibbons from Australia (ASP World #2) and Chelsea Tuach from Barbados (ISA World #9 Juniors) kicked it together in the tropics and surfed Soup Bowl in Barbados. They have been training together everyday, and have left the spectators speechless with their surfing!

Chelsea will be representing Barbados at the Pan American Surfing Games in Guadeloupe right after surfing in the Rip Curl Grom Search Finals in San Francisco.

Sally has not only had an amazing year, finishing second in the world, but the Australian contest machine is constantly pushing herself and pushing women’s surfing to the next level.
